Is Dr. Latham returning to Chicago Med for the upcoming third season? Obviously, he’s a character who really should be back.

When you think about this character, there is really nobody else out there quite like him. He is black, an orthodox Jew, on the autism spectrum, and one of the most brilliant medical professionals that Chicago Med has. While his bedside manner and communication with other doctors often does leave something to be desired, he’s shown a knack for treatment and getting the job done like few others. At times his attempts as of late to communicate and open up have left him more vulnerable, but that is just a fascinating part of his journey. He’s going to have bumps in the road as he figures out things for the first time. The character is performed beautifully by Ato Essandoh, and we were lucky to speak with him earlier this year about what goes into playing the part.

Well, the good news now is that there is no need to be concerned about whether or not Essandoh is returning as Latham, because he is! The actor actually confirmed that earlier this summer by getting involved in one of the country’s greatest trends of the past month: Standing outside and staring at the eclipse. (Luckily, he was wearing the proper glasses — we don’t need Latham to lose his vision!) This it’s not clear as of yet how many episodes he’ll be a part of, his story is very much linked to Connor Rhodes’ (Colin Donnell) and we’d love to see him work even more with some other characters. If we were to have it our way, we would promote him to series regular and just keep him around permanently, but we also know that Essandoh has a lot of other things going on and it may be nice to step into a wide array of different projects.
